Codford Community – A Vibrant Wiltshire Village in the Wylye Valley
Codford is a charming and historic village community in Wiltshire, England, nestled in the scenic Wylye Valley near Salisbury Plain. Comprising Codford St Peter and Codford St Mary, the village offers a rich blend of countryside living and modern convenience, with amenities including a village shop, post office, primary school, GP surgery, theatre, and the popular Codford Village Hall and Broadleaze Bar.
Known for its strong community spirit, Codford hosts regular local events, sports activities, and cultural gatherings.
With easy access to Salisbury, Bath, and Warminster via the A36, Codford is ideal for families, retirees, and visitors seeking a peaceful rural lifestyle. Whether you're looking for a welcoming place to live, explore, or invest, Codford is a hidden gem in the heart of Wiltshire.

This annual village event always takes place on the first Saturday of July (this year being on the 5th); it is a unique collaboration between local people and UK based Australian Defence Forces personnel who get together each year to keep our treasured World War 1 memorial in good shape. This year was a 'vintage' one, with a good turnout of locals and a strong Aussie contingent including a dozen members of their Ukrainian training team coming down from East Anglia - July 2025.
